#6235da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6235da is composed of 38.4% red, 20.8%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55% cyan, 75.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 256.4 degrees, a saturation of 69% and a lightness of 53.1%. #6235da color hex could be obtained by blending #c46aff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#6235da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6235da has RGB values of R:98, G:53,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.76,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 6436314.
